In-Deep Community Task Force

About the service

In-Deep Community Task Force is a grassroots charity working with isolated older people and children with Special Education Needs (SEND) and their families in Westminster, Kensington and Chelsea, Lambeth and surrounding areas. We aim to promote friendship and understanding in the community, and tackle loneliness and isolation by bringing people together to take part in meaningful activities. We offer a range of services and support for those in need.

RBKC Young Carers Personal Budgets Service

About the service

Young Carers are those under the age of 18 who provide care to another family who has a physical illness or disability, a mental health illness, sensory disability, learning difficulties or missuses alcohol or drugs.

RBKC Young Carers Personal Budgets Service can provide up to £150 for young carers to use on a physical activity outside of the home. Examples of activities they have funded for our young carers include ballet classes, swimming lessons, horse riding, boxing, dancing and private football coaching, just to name a few.

The Dalgarno Trust

About the service

The Dalgarno Trust is a community centre, offering a wide range of activities, projects and services that promote health, wellbeing and inclusion for all ages.

Current programmes at Dalgarno:

  • Community Champions: Activities for locals, ranging from baby stay and play sessions to sewing workshops, run by our local team of Community Champion and Maternity Champion volunteers
  • HealthWorks Enables: Dalgarno Trust works in partnership with local Black, Asian and minortiy ethnic organisations to provide health and wellbeing projects
  • Dalgarno Youth Programme: After-school and holiday clubs for seven to 18 year olds
  • Digital Champions: Helps the digitally excluded to learn skills to use IT

The Dalgarno Trust also runs a Foodbank every Thursday.
